Transaction 8609742e65d4ec8cfda82efc935d58c8923747cefa60495afbb86b16d71fc076
1 Input
1 Output
-
8609742e65d4ec8cfda82efc935d58c8923747cefa60495afbb86b16d71fc076:0
- value
- 55700
- script pubkey
- OP_0 OP_PUSHBYTES_20 07084927668c6c660fc96e7e4304711c261a750c
- address
- bc1qquyyjfmx33kxvr7fdelyxpr3rsnp5agv9ptd3r